Here is Schneider Xenon 50mm f0.95 c-mount cine lens:
http://cgi.ebay.com/Schneider-Xenon-50mm-f0-95-C-MOUNT-m4-3-NEX-Leica-M-/270772552158

The lens can be used with m4/3 (E-P1, GH-1, AG-AF100) and Sony NEX (NEX-VG10) cameras with c-mount - m4/3 (c-mount - E-mount) adapters.

Also the lens can be modified into the Leica M mount by a Japanese specialist "Mr. Miyazaki". It will cost a few hundred dollars: http://www.japanexposures.com/services/#lens

Lens Construction : 6 groups 8elements
Smallest Aperture : close (indication F11)
Picture Angle : 45° ?
Aperture Blades : 6
Nearest Distance : 0.7m (It works with the range finder!!!)
Diameter x Length : φ62mm x 88mm
Filter Size : 58mm
Weight : nearly 800g
